Output 43d75779a661d3803dd66b17fa57ba8a70bfaf90c5f84eea35cc5e48a114aa07:1

value
151432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7307fc5e84c91a879a8f1c6bb888590539b60f0b OP_EQUALVERIFY OP_CHECKSIG
address
1BVEGve44DSUtyku5fmZUu3ae8nprxJqrW
transaction
43d75779a661d3803dd66b17fa57ba8a70bfaf90c5f84eea35cc5e48a114aa07
confirmations
384882
spent
true